A math class has 3 girls and 9 boys in the seventh grade and 7 girls and 3 boys in the eighth grade. The teacher randomly select

s a seventh grader and an
eighth grader from the class for competition. What is the probability that the students she selects are both girls?
Write your answer as a fraction in simplest form.
Mathematics
1 answer:
vladimir1956 [14]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

7/40

Step-by-step explanation:

There are 3 girls+9 boys = 12 students in the 7th grade

P (girl in 7th grade) = girls/ total

                                = 3/12 = 1/4

There are 7 girls+3 boys = 10 students in the 8th grade

P (girl in 8th grade) = girls/ total

                                = 7/10

P(7th grade girl, 8th grade girl) = 1/4 * 7/10 = 7/40

The difference of two positive numbers is 69. The quotient obtained on dividing one by the other is 4. Find the number.​
valentinak56 [21]

Answer:

x=92 y=23

Step-by-step explanation:

Let them be x and y respectively

so given

x-y=69

and

x/y=4  x=4y

so we can write

x-y=69

as

4y-y=69  3y=69 y= 69/3 = 23

now y is 23

so putting in any equation will give the value of x

so

x-23=69 x=92

Find the volume of a cone with a base diameter of 12 m and a height of 10 m.
dexar [7]

Answer:

=376.8 m^{3}

Step-by-step explanation:

V=nr^{2}  \frac{h}{3}  Where V is the volume , r is the radius and h is the perpendicular height .

r = \frac{12}{2} m=6

h = 10m

n=3.14

v= 3.14 * 6*6 *\frac{10}{3}

=376.8 m^{3}
